		Before You Start Packing
	
		 
	
		Before going for Umrah, it's important to consider the weather conditions of the destination. Since Mecca and Medina generally have a hot climate, clothes made from non-sweating, breathable fabrics should be chosen. Also, creating a list before packing your suitcase will make your job easier, ensuring nothing is missed. Tip: To avoid unnecessary weight, eliminate "maybe I'll need it" items and only take what is truly necessary.
	
		 
	
		Clothing Selection: Suggestions for Covered Women
	
		 
	
		Ferah and Abayas/Dresses Comfortable feraces (long, loose over-garments) and loose dresses are the most ideal choices for both tawaf (circumambulation) and other acts of worship during Umrah. 		Underwear, Nightwear, and Comfortable Clothes Cotton innerwear, moisture-wicking pajamas, and soft nightgowns should definitely be in your suitcase. They provide comfortable rest after a full day of worship.
	
		 
	
		Shoes and Slippers Orthopedic-soled shoes or flat ballet flats are ideal for long walks. Remember to also bring a comfortable pair of slippers for inside the hotel or after ablution (wudu).
	
		 
	
		Essentials for Worship
	
		 
	
		Prayer Rug (thin, easily portable model can be preferred)
	
		Prayer beads (tesbih) or a digital counter
	
		Small-sized Holy Quran
	
		Ablution Towel
	
		Socks
	
		Additionally, a small crossbody bag worn over the shoulder during tawaf helps keep your belongings organized.
	
		 
	
		Personal Care Products
	
		 
	
		Care products used during Umrah should be simple, unscented, and practical.
	
		Be sure to add these to your suitcase:
	
		Travel-sized shampoo, soap, toothpaste
	
		Moisturizer and sunscreen
	
		Lip balm
	
		Wet wipes, cologne (alcohol-based hand sanitizer), mask
	
		Small sewing kit and basic medications
	
		You can keep your care items organized with small travel bags.
	
		 
	
		Suitcase Organization and Packing Tips
	
		Roll your clothes to save space.
	
		Use small bags for each category (clothing, care, worship).
	
		Plan daily outfits in advance to avoid carrying excess luggage.
	
		Place the items you use most frequently where they are easily accessible.
